If you are planning to open a sportsbook, it’s important to find a reliable technology provider. This is because you’ll want to ensure that your sportsbook can scale as your user base grows. If you don’t have a solid technology foundation, your business could suffer from problems down the road.

It’s also a good idea to use a sportsbook that offers multiple payment methods. This will give you more flexibility and help you retain your users. It’s also a good idea to include a rewards system in your sportsbook to encourage your users to return and refer friends and family to the site.

The fourth mistake is not focusing on the user experience and design of your sportsbook. This is a major mistake because if your sportsbook doesn’t have an engaging UX or design, users will not be drawn back to it.

In addition, it’s important to avoid using a turnkey solution for your sportsbook. This is because a turnkey solution can limit your ability to customize the product and may be subject to unforeseen changes that could affect your business. For this reason, you should choose a provider that provides a customizable solution that can adapt to the changing needs of your market. This will help you to build an engaging sportsbook that will attract and retain customers. In addition, it will also ensure that your sportsbook is profitable year-round.
